AXForum  
Вернуться   AXForum > Microsoft Dynamics NAV > NAV: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 16.04.2010, 11:42   #1  
Yakuza is offline
Yakuza
Участник
 
124 / 10 (1) +
Регистрация: 26.10.2004
Нужно раз в сутки запускать отчет или код, чтобы снимать данные для статистики и писать в отдельную таблицу. Своего шедулера во второй версии нет. Пока в голову приходит только какой-то сторонний шедулер, способный запускать клиент навижн, логиниться, отрабатывать код и закрывать клиента. Может кто решал такую проблему и может посоветовать шедулер ?
Старый 16.04.2010, 12:00   #2  
Fordewind is offline
Fordewind
Участник
 
1,134 / 10 (3) +
Регистрация: 01.12.2005
Цитата:
Сообщение от Yakuza Посмотреть сообщение
Нужно раз в сутки запускать отчет или код, чтобы снимать данные для статистики и писать в отдельную таблицу. Своего шедулера во второй версии нет. Пока в голову приходит только какой-то сторонний шедулер, способный запускать клиент навижн, логиниться, отрабатывать код и закрывать клиента. Может кто решал такую проблему и может посоветовать шедулер ?
А Navision Application Server там есть?
Старый 16.04.2010, 12:26   #3  
Yakuza is offline
Yakuza
Участник
 
124 / 10 (1) +
Регистрация: 26.10.2004
Цитата:
Сообщение от Fordewind Посмотреть сообщение
Цитата:
Сообщение от Yakuza Посмотреть сообщение
Нужно раз в сутки запускать отчет или код, чтобы снимать данные для статистики и писать в отдельную таблицу. Своего шедулера во второй версии нет. Пока в голову приходит только какой-то сторонний шедулер, способный запускать клиент навижн, логиниться, отрабатывать код и закрывать клиента. Может кто решал такую проблему и может посоветовать шедулер ?
А Navision Application Server там есть?
В лицензии вроде бы есть гранула 1420 Application Server. Но никогда не пользовались.
Старый 16.04.2010, 13:20   #4  
Sancho is offline
Sancho
Administrator
Аватар для Sancho
Лучший по профессии 2017
Лучший по профессии 2009
 
1,294 / 221 (10) ++++++
Регистрация: 11.01.2006
взять шедулер из 3-й версии, оставлять одну сессию открытой
шедулер нужен? попробую выложить тут. немного исправленный
Старый 16.04.2010, 13:22   #5  
Sancho is offline
Sancho
Administrator
Аватар для Sancho
Лучший по профессии 2017
Лучший по профессии 2009
 
1,294 / 221 (10) ++++++
Регистрация: 11.01.2006
вот он
Вложения
Тип файла: rar шедулер.rar (19.0 Кб, 29 просмотров)
Старый 16.04.2010, 13:33   #6  
Fordewind is offline
Fordewind
Участник
 
1,134 / 10 (3) +
Регистрация: 01.12.2005
Цитата:
Сообщение от Yakuza Посмотреть сообщение
Цитата:
Сообщение от Fordewind Посмотреть сообщение
Цитата:
Сообщение от Yakuza Посмотреть сообщение
Нужно раз в сутки запускать отчет или код, чтобы снимать данные для статистики и писать в отдельную таблицу. Своего шедулера во второй версии нет. Пока в голову приходит только какой-то сторонний шедулер, способный запускать клиент навижн, логиниться, отрабатывать код и закрывать клиента. Может кто решал такую проблему и может посоветовать шедулер ?
А Navision Application Server там есть?
В лицензии вроде бы есть гранула 1420 Application Server. Но никогда не пользовались.
Тогда по идее, где то в дистрибутиве должен быть сам этот сервер приложений.
Возьмите то, что выложит Sancho. И если хотите сэкономить сессию, то работайте с шедулером через NAS
Старый 16.04.2010, 13:45   #7  
Yakuza is offline
Yakuza
Участник
 
124 / 10 (1) +
Регистрация: 26.10.2004
Цитата:
Сообщение от Sancho Посмотреть сообщение
вот он
Спасибо, только можно его в текстовом формате выложить, боюсь не импортнется он у меня. У меня вообще таблиц с четырехзначными номерами нету, пользовательский диапазон начинается с 50000...
Старый 20.04.2010, 11:55   #8  
Storkich is offline
Storkich
Участник
 
149 / 10 (1) +
Регистрация: 08.03.2007
Попробуй создать ярлык с такой строкой
navision://client/run?servername=MyServer%26database=MyBase%26company=MyCompany%26target=Report%2050001%26view=SORTING(Field1)%26requestform=Нет%26servertype=MSSQL
Должен запуститься с репорт 50005

Поменяй параметры под себя.
Или открой репорт, Файл - Отправить - Ссылка на рабочий стол.
Дальше пытайся запускать этот ярлык по расписанию.
Старый 20.04.2010, 13:54   #9  
Sancho is offline
Sancho
Administrator
Аватар для Sancho
Лучший по профессии 2017
Лучший по профессии 2009
 
1,294 / 221 (10) ++++++
Регистрация: 11.01.2006
Цитата:
Сообщение от Yakuza Посмотреть сообщение
Цитата:
Сообщение от Sancho Посмотреть сообщение
вот он
Спасибо, только можно его в текстовом формате выложить, боюсь не импортнется он у меня. У меня вообще таблиц с четырехзначными номерами нету, пользовательский диапазон начинается с 50000...
не совсем понял что делать.
это стандартные (незадокументированные) объекты Нава 3. отсюда и такой диапазон. они не работали по-человечески, их исправили.
не заливаются?
перекомпилячить их на диапазон 50000+ и выложить в текст?
тогда сразу напишите необходимый диапазон, все равно перекомпилячивать...
там 3 таблицы и 2 формы, насколько я помню.
вечерком перекомпилячу... могу и перекомпилятор выложить
Старый 21.04.2010, 12:16   #10  
Yakuza is offline
Yakuza
Участник
 
124 / 10 (1) +
Регистрация: 26.10.2004
Цитата:
Сообщение от Sancho Посмотреть сообщение
Цитата:
Сообщение от Yakuza Посмотреть сообщение
Цитата:
Сообщение от Sancho Посмотреть сообщение
вот он
Спасибо, только можно его в текстовом формате выложить, боюсь не импортнется он у меня. У меня вообще таблиц с четырехзначными номерами нету, пользовательский диапазон начинается с 50000...
не совсем понял что делать.
это стандартные (незадокументированные) объекты Нава 3. отсюда и такой диапазон. они не работали по-человечески, их исправили.
не заливаются?
перекомпилячить их на диапазон 50000+ и выложить в текст?
тогда сразу напишите необходимый диапазон, все равно перекомпилячивать...
там 3 таблицы и 2 формы, насколько я помню.
вечерком перекомпилячу... могу и перекомпилятор выложить
Просто во второй версии пользовательский диапазон с 50000 начинается. При экспорте разве в трешке нет возможности в текством виде записать ? Там чистый код, я бы просто номера объектов поправил бы и все. Просто не факт еще, что даже в новом диапазоне импортироваться будет, может прижется руками что-то в тексте править.
Старый 21.04.2010, 12:18   #11  
Yakuza is offline
Yakuza
Участник
 
124 / 10 (1) +
Регистрация: 26.10.2004
Цитата:
Сообщение от Storkich Посмотреть сообщение
Попробуй создать ярлык с такой строкой
navision://client/run?servername=MyServer%26database=MyBase%26company=MyCompany%26target=Report%2050001%26view=SORTING(Field1)%26requestform=Нет%26servertype=MSSQL
Должен запуститься с репорт 50005

Поменяй параметры под себя.
Или открой репорт, Файл - Отправить - Ссылка на рабочий стол.
Дальше пытайся запускать этот ярлык по расписанию.
Такое у меня не будет работать. Во второй версии нет sql, с базой можно работать через odbc только. А запустить объект снаружи вообще нереально.
 


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 01:26.